Trueface.ai a 500 Startups alumni, launches IDVerify to simplify onboarding and KYC AML compliance
SAN FRANCISCO (PRWEB) January 29, 2018 -- Trueface.ai, a 500 Startups Batch 22 alumni has launched an innovative identity verification solution for businesses ranging from startups to enterprises. Offered as both an API and a code free solution, the service simplifies physical and remote identity verification for use cases that include account openings, securing high value transactions, proctoring, e-learning and more.
As more of our critical information and important transactions shift online, Trueface.ai is creating digital identity verification solutions to increase security and safety. To date, Trueface.ai solutions include state-of-the-art facial recognition, proprietary spoof detection that works on single static images (ensuring a proof of possession and presence), document verification, AML/PEP sanction checks and web verification, which can source public social media information and generate challenge questions to be asked to the individual.
The technology works with identity documents from over 150 countries and can be used via Trueface.ai’s web and mobile applications without writing one line of code. Trueface.ai also offers an API, mobile SDKs, and HTML widgets to simplify integrations. The service is already used by online notaries, fintech startups, e-learning firms and rental companies.
Shaun Moore, CEO of Trueface.ai believes “online identity fraud is becoming an increasingly more difficult problem for companies to mitigate and we built this tool so that businesses of any size can use our cutting edge technology to be confident they know who they are working with.”
The company’s technology uses deep learning to extract, normalize, magnify, validate and match faces on identity documents. About Trueface.ai:
Trueface.ai was born out of Chui, a facial recognition access control system, and launched in June of 2017 on Product Hunt. After three years in the commercial access control industry the team recognized a larger paradigm shift in the digitization of information and transactions and a need for these digital actions to be verified securely.
